Eric Mann talks with Bill Fletcher, Jr. on good faith and cynicism about President-Elect Barack Obama. Fletcher, longtime Black Liberation Movement and union leader and editor of the Black Commentator [2], says "while condemnations of Obama as a betrayer completely exaggerate what is going on, relying on good-faith and the hidden intentions of the President-elect is a recipe for an upset stomach....it is up to progressive social movements and activists to shape Obama and the Obama administration in the way that we believe it needs to be shaped."
